The dumbest rally/protest ever
The "support the troops" rally held
in front of Central Hall yesterday evening, as well as the "bring
'em home" counter-rally held fifty yards away in front
of Moss Hall, were the most pathetic displays of political activism
we have ever seen.
The scene was comic: About 50 people stood
around holding mini American flags and chatting-not chanting-while
a few aged security guards strolled about the perimeter of the
campus, presumably to protect Rep. Mike Rogers, who never showed
up. Even better was the counter-rally: five or six scruffy-looking
students standing around despondently in front of Moss Hall
smoking cigarettes, complaining, making fun of conservatives
and staring at their hand-made protest signs.
If yesterday's "rally" accomplished
nothing else, it proved that this sort of thing should never
be attempted at Hillsdale again, unless the two sides square
off and try to shout each other down or throw stones or something.
We'd be up for watching that. At least it would be entertaining,
and not so dorky.
